KUCHING - Mark your calendar and plan your day to visit our exhibition on Special Collection : Japanese Occupation in Borneo during World War II starting today until 31 July 2016. The exhibition will take place at Special Collection Room, Level 1, Pustaka Negeri Sarawak.
In 1941, the British surrendered Borneo to the
victorious Imperial Japanese Army. Japan’s Rising Sun flag now flew from all
corners of the city, heralding the start of one of the darkest chapter in
Borneo history.
This exhibition highlight on how the people of
Borneo survived with daily life and responded with grit and resourcefulness to
the Japanese Occupation, a period of great adversity and abject scarcity. It
celebrates their resilience, tenacity, resourcefulness and self-reliance;
values that remain important and relevant today.
Glimpses of these past lives are presented in
writings, memoirs, records, and photos of the uncertain and shattered world
these survivors of the war endured.
The free admission exhibition is open to public
daily from 11 am - 7 pm and closed on Public Holidays.
